Mark Lodge No. 2 Inspection

No pictures last night.   Mark Lodge No. 2 meets in Cleveland Masonic Temple on Euclid Avenue.  Naturally they meet in what is called the DeMolay room.   A nice big room but nothing really elaborate.   There was one new wrinkle last night.   The Mark Lodge members were wearing new aprons designed for them.   It is white with a purple border.   There is a square and compasses on the flap.  On the body of the apron there is a key stone.   They are quite nice.   The lodge is selling them for $50 as a fund raiser.   Members also buy one and donate it to the new Mark Master.   This was done last night.
